Is All Pasta Vegan?<\/h3>\n

No, all pasta is NOT vegan. But, two things are generally true: 1) Most dried pasta is vegan, and 2) Most fresh pasta is not vegan.<\/p>\n

Most varieties of dried pasta, which are often boxed, are vegan because they need to be made with more shelf-stable<\/a> ingredients. Because many animal products like eggs and milk are not shelf-stable, they are usually left out of these products.<\/p>\n

On the other hand, fresh pasta does not need to be shelf-stable because it is often refrigerated. Fresh pasta tends to have animal products like milk and eggs, but there are some varieties of vegan fresh pasta.<\/p>\n

How to Tell if Pasta Is Vegan Friendly<\/h3>\n

To tell which pasta is vegan, you just have to read the label and make sure that all of the ingredients are vegan-friendly.<\/p>\n

This might be a simple task when it comes to fresh pasta because many of the non-vegan ingredients are obvious, such as eggs or milk.<\/p>\n
